Within Care and Rehabilitation Services, the philosophy of our prisons is to rehabilitate offenders and equip them to re-integrate into mainstream society on release. We seek to normalise prison conditions as far as possible to reflect life in the outside community. Our aim is to create an environment in which staff and prisoners feel safe and causes of prison stress are minimised. Central to our philosophy is the relationship between staff and prisoners. Our training and operational practices emphasise the need to treat prisoners with dignity and respect and G4S staff build positive and supportive relationships with the prisoners in their care.
HMP Rye Hill is a category 'B' training prison situated in the village of Willoughby, near Rugby in Warwickshire, holding approximately 664 sentenced male adults.
HMP Rye Hill is now looking for full-time Security Officers (SO) to join the Security Team.
Key responsibilities in the role include:
Search Vehicles, Occupants of Vehicles, Visitors and their property on access or egress through the prison lock, using Technical Aids, to ensure the Security of the Prison is maintained.
Participate with ‘Internal’ and ‘External’ Vehicle Escorts and Patrols where necessary, wearing the correct High Visibility PPE ensuring compliance with Contractual Requirements.
Monitor and operate CCTV Cameras (including Visits CCTV), and Radio Network in line with relevant procedures to maintain Prison Security.
Issue Keys, Tallies and Radios to authorised personnel and ensure Security Keys are not removed from the Prison, reporting all discrepancies immediately to the Duty Manager. To complete the correct Gate Logs for issuing Loan Keys, Radios and Key Boxes
Answer and screen ‘Internal’ and ‘External’ telephone calls , to ensure they are identified before being directed to the correct point of contact or ‘Messages’ are taken and passed on to the appropriate person for action or response.
Issue all Authorised Visitors are enter on the CMS and issued with a Valid Pass before they enter the Prison and ensure all Tool Check Lists are completed for contractors’ equipment entering and exiting the Prison maintaining Prison Security.
Monitor and respond to situations as they arise using the appropriate equipment to ensure that situations are dealt with promptly and the appropriate action/response is taken.
Co-ordinate, control and monitor the movement of Staff, Prisoners and Visitors around the establishment to ensure they arrive at the correct destination Safely and Securely in a timely and efficient manner.
Maintain Security in the Visitors Centre, ensuring that the building is searched and locked at the end of each session, reporting any unusual occurrence to the Duty Manager. (Day Duties only).
